Carers Rights Day and Carers
Week
is a day in December and a
week in June respectively, when
events are run across the UK to raise
awareness of the needs of Carers and
to inform those who are unaware of
the services and benefits to which
they are entitled.

Carers Trust
(formed by the merger
of Crossroads Care and the Princess
Royal Trust for Carers) provides
practical support to Carers through
the provision of trained care support
workers who can provide respite for
the carer and a network of
independently managed Carers
centres and young Carers services.

Crossroads Care Cwm Taf
is a
charity and network partner of The
Carers Trust and look after the cared
for in the comfort of their own home,
providing quality free time for carers.
